Gemmy Spessartine Garnets on Smoky Quartz from Wushan Mine, China
Dimension: 5.5cm x 1.3cm x 1.2cm
Weight: 9g
Locality: Wushan Mine, Tongbei, Yunxiao Co., Zhangzhou Prefecture, Fujian Province, China
Gemmy and sparkly Spessartine Garnets on smoky quartz from Wushan Mine of China. Lustrous beautiful Garnets richly sprinkled on five sides of the smoky quartz prisms with a uniform bright orange to cinnamon-orange color. It is pefectly terminated and the largest Spessartine Garnet is of 0.5cm across. The Smoky Quartz is between transparent to translucent.
The first specimens of Chinese garnet associated with smoky quartz and feldspar appeared on the market in 1998. After many years of plentiful specimens, this locality has pretty much been depleted and had been shut down by the Chinese government many years ago.
